Discover the Health Benefits and Culinary Uses of the Ground Cherry Plant

Posted on April 10, 2026 by PR Blogs Author

The ground cherry plant is a fascinating botanical wonder, often overlooked despite its nutritional benefits and versatile culinary uses. Known for its small, golden fruits enveloped in papery husks, this plant belongs to the nightshade family and thrives in warmer climates. Whether you’re a gardening enthusiast or a culinary adventurer, understanding the ground cherry plant can open up a world of possibilities for adding unique flavors and nutrients to your meals.

Health Benefits of the Ground Cherry Plant

Ground cherries are not only delightful to taste but also packed with essential nutrients. These fruits are rich in vitamins A and C, which play a critical role in supporting immune function and maintaining healthy skin and vision. Additionally, they contain dietary fiber, which aids in digestion and helps maintain a healthy weight by promoting a feeling of fullness.

Studies have shown that the antioxidants present in ground cherries may help reduce inflammation and lower the risk of chronic diseases. They also contain small amounts of minerals like calcium, iron, and potassium, which contribute to bone health and optimal muscle function. While more research is needed to fully explore their health implications, ground cherries are a nutritious addition to a balanced diet.

Culinary Uses of Ground Cherries

The unique flavor profile of ground cherries, which is reminiscent of pineapples and tomatoes, makes them a versatile ingredient in the kitchen. Here are some popular ways to incorporate ground cherries into your meals:

  • Sauces and Preserves: Ground cherries can be cooked down with sugar and spices to create delicious jams and sauces. Their natural sweetness pairs well with savory dishes as well.
  • Salads: Add halved ground cherries to salads for a burst of sweetness and color. They complement a variety of greens and are excellent in fruit salads.
  • Baking: Incorporate them into baked goods like muffins, pies, and tarts. Their unique taste adds a delightful twist to traditional recipes.
  • Snacking: Simply peeling back the husk and eating them raw is a simple, healthy snack option that’s both sweet and refreshing.

Tending to the Ground Cherry Plant

Tending to ground cherry plants is relatively straightforward, making them a favorite among gardeners. They thrive in well-drained soil exposed to full sunlight. Regular watering is key, especially during dry spells, to ensure that the plant produces abundant fruits. Ground cherries are generally resistant to many pests, but it’s important to monitor for common issues like aphids and spider mites.

Ground cherry plants can be started from seeds indoors and transplanted outdoors after the last frost. With good care, they will reward you with a plentiful harvest that can be enjoyed throughout the growing season.

What are ground cherries?

Ground cherries are small, sweet fruits that grow enclosed in a papery husk. They belong to the nightshade family and are known for their unique taste.

Can you eat ground cherries raw?

Yes, ground cherries can be eaten raw. Simply peel back the husk and enjoy them as a sweet, refreshing snack.

Are ground cherries the same as tomatillos?

While both ground cherries and tomatillos are part of the nightshade family and have a similar husk, they differ in taste and size. Ground cherries are smaller and sweeter than tomatillos.

How do you store ground cherries?

Ground cherries can be stored in their husks at room temperature for a few days. For longer storage, keep them in the refrigerator where they can last for up to two weeks.

Are there any health benefits to ground cherries?

Ground cherries are nutritious, containing vitamins A and C, fiber, and antioxidants. These nutrients may help support immunity, digestion, and overall health.
